Yemen‘s Houthi Rebels Suffer High-Profile Losses in Recent Strike

A recent⁣ attack⁣ in Yemen’s capital, Sanaa, has resulted in the deaths of several ⁣high-ranking government officials, escalating tensions in a region already grappling with conflict.‍ This strike, carried out on Thursday, represents a notable blow to the ⁣houthi rebel group and‍ raises concerns about further escalation.

Key Officials Killed

Among those ⁢confirmed dead are several pivotal figures within⁣ the Houthi-controlled government. These include:

Prime Minister Ahmed al-Rahawi.
Foreign Minister Gamal Amer.
Deputy Prime Minister and Minister of Local Development Mohammed al-Medani.
Electricity Minister Ali Seif Hassan.
⁣ Tourism Minister⁢ Ali al-Yafei.
Facts ‍Minister Hashim Sharafuldin.
* Deputy Interior Minister Abdel-Majed al-Murtada, a particularly ⁤powerful figure.

These losses represent a substantial disruption to the Houthi administration. A funeral for the victims is scheduled for⁢ Monday in Sanaa’s Sabeen Square.

Context of the Attack

The officials were reportedly attending a routine workshop focused on evaluating the⁣ government’s performance over the⁤ past year when the strike occurred. Defense Minister Mohamed Nasser al-Attefi survived the‍ attack, and Interior Minister Abdel-Karim al-Houthi was absent from‍ the meeting.

This attack follows a recent escalation in Houthi actions against Israel.On August 21st, ⁢the Houthis launched a ballistic⁢ missile towards Israel, described by the Israeli military ⁤as the first instance of cluster bomb use by the rebels as 2023. ⁣This missile triggered air raid sirens across central Israel and Jerusalem, sending millions scrambling for shelter.

Escalating Regional Tensions

the Houthis have⁤ vowed ⁣to target merchant ships linked to Israeli ports, nonetheless of thier nationality. This‍ pledge, made in July, signals a potential expansion of the conflict to ⁣include maritime trade routes.

In a televised speech on Sunday, the Houthi leader emphasized a continued and escalating military approach against Israel. He specifically mentioned⁣ targeting ‍with missiles, drones, and a naval blockade. ‍You can anticipate further attacks on Israel and increased disruption in the Red Sea.
